In keeping with our commitment to share merger-related news as soon as possible, I want to provide you with an update regarding one of the expected regulatory reviews mentioned in prior messages. As previously communicated, this transaction is subject to review by anti-trust regulators, and the review process can be led by either the Department of Justice (DOJ) or the Federal Trade Commission (FTC). Regulators have thirty (30) days after the parties file notice of the transaction to respond; in our case that 30 day timeframe ends on Friday, April 8.
Last Friday, our attorneys were informed that the anti-trust review had been assigned to the FTC. Unfortunately, because the FTC was not able to begin its review until late last week they will not be able to complete the process by April 8. As a result, we have voluntarily extended the initial anti-trust review by a period of 30 days to permit the FTC to complete its normal review process.. If the FTC completes its review before the expiration of the 30 day period, then they can provide clearance before the end of the full 30 days. Even if they take the full 30 days to complete the process, we anticipate receiving clearance from the FTC around the beginning of May.
We do not believe that this re-filing will change the timing of our expected merger. We still hope and expect that we will be able to complete all requirements and close the transaction by early June.
